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42363 17956400 15168913
24 8927 64
24 8927 64
01 19337990 45840 45857
All about undefined
Interested in learning more?
24 8927 64
01 19337990 45840 45857
See more
39445378123 38264 90
024 377593336 50 0920538376
See more
249 9302120 042315
95 57029001 73720 830209
See more